I have a post relationship with a custom field of the checkbox type. Within a post, when I go to "quick edit" of the related post, I want to be able to uncheck the box and save it by clicking Update for the relationship, and Update again for the post. This fails with the error "The related content has not been updated, as no fields were modified."
The other way around does work: I can check an unchecked box and save it. But to uncheck it, I need to remove the relationship and add it again.

I assume we are talking about many-to-many relationship, as you mentioned above it is a known "Regression" issue, and had been escalated again, but I am not sure when will it be fixed, and I have add this thread to our to-do list, hope it can raise attention.
Currently, please try these:
1) Edit the many-to-many relationship, enable option "Intermediary Post Type visible in WordPress admin menu"
2) So you will be able to see the Intermediary Post Type in WordPress dashboard, edit each Intermediary Post and change the custom checkbox field directly.
